LSO Office Hours at MIP: Navigating the Life Sciences Ecosystem

As a founder, finding the time to hunt for these connections can feel like a secondary full-time job. To support your growth, LSO is collaborating with McMaster Innovation Park (MIP) to host Office Hours, a dedicated initiative designed to bring provincial expertise directly to your doorstep. Join for an individual session to gain high-level insights into the life sciences landscape and discover how to align your business objectives with the right opportunities.

What you’ll learn:

  • Identify potential funding pathways and provincial resources tailored to your stage of growth.
  • Refine your brand positioning and audience engagement strategies within the healthcare and research sectors.
  • Navigate the life sciences ecosystem with a clearer understanding of key stakeholders and strategic partners.
  • Discuss your specific business goals in a 1:1 setting to receive personalized, actionable feedback.

For startups in the Hamilton and Halton regions, access to Life Sciences Ontario (LSO) represents a vital link to the broader provincial economy. This pilot program fosters a stronger innovation ecosystem by lowering the barriers between founders and the strategic advice they need to scale.

Who should attend

  • Early-stage and scaling life science founders located at McMaster Innovation Park.
  • Biotech and medtech entrepreneurs seeking guidance on funding and ecosystem navigation.
  • Business development professionals looking to enhance their company’s provincial network.

Meet the speaker

Andy Donovan, Vice President, Strategic Partnerships at Life Sciences Ontario (LSO)

Andy brings over 30 years of expertise in business development, consulting, and fundraising. He is known for a highly collaborative approach, focusing on connecting organizations with the specific partners and networks needed to drive both financial and non-financial success.

How to Book

This opportunity is available to all companies across MIP, and we encourage you to take advantage of this chance to tap into LSO’s network and expertise.

If you’re interested in booking a 1:1 meeting, please email Andy directly at [email protected].

The first session will take place on Friday, April 17 from 9:00 AM – 3:00 PM, in MIP office suite 101A (The Atrium, 175 Longwood Rd S).
